Some teaching jobs require as little as a two-year associate degree, though the majority require at least a bachelor's degree. A bachelor's degree is the most popular degree for teachers and is the minimum requirement for most teacher careers. Teaching is not a 9-to-5 job; most teachers work beyond school hours. They work at night and weekends from home, creating lesson plans, writing classroom notes, and grading papers. They also attend parent-teacher meetings and school functions, as well as professional development classes, educator meetings, and conferences. 4.

International research evidence suggests that a diminishing prestige of the teaching profession together with dissatisfying …Many teachers work a traditional 10-month school year and have a 2-month break during the summer. They also have a short midwinter break. Some teachers work during the summer. Teachers in districts with a year-round schedule typically work 9 weeks in a row and then have a break for 3 weeks before starting a new school session.

These charts show the average base salary (core compensation), as well as the average total cash compensation for the job of Teacher in the United States. The base salary for Teacher ranges from $48,639 to $70,934 with the average base salary of $58,173. Teacher Superstore is an accredited supplier of educational resources and classroom supplies to …Jun 30, 2022 · On average, substitute teachers can earn anywhere from $75 to $200 for a full day’s work. But s ub pay varies greatly from state to state and between urban and rural communities. Some districts offer incentive pay for high volume days like Friday and Monday.
